Alarm profiles are used to control the actions the D3 base station will take in the event of an alarm event being triggered. Alarms are triggered when data received exceeds the limits of your set points (after any alarm delay you have allowed has elapsed). Alarm profiles can be created based on your alarm requirements…

There’s 3 options available when networking a D3 base station: DHCP Client: when the network assigns IP settings automatically Static: when settings are manually input – see Networking a D3 DHCP Server: when connecting directly to a PC or Laptop DHCP Client and Static are the most popular options used among D3 system users. Alarm profiles are used to control the actions of the base station should a sensor/repeater or system warning alarm be generated. Multiple profiles can be created on a base station, however a device can only be attached to a single profile. For more information see Alarm Profiles Explained. From factory, the D3 family of base…
